15th Annual Community Bank 'Makin' Tracks' 5K Run/Walk

September 15, 2012 at 08:00 AM

The 15th Annual Community Bank “Makin’ Tracks” 5K Run/Walk" will be held Sept. 15, in River Forest. The event is sponsored by the Community Bank of Oak Park River Forest, the River Forest Park District, Concordia University Chicago and Fenwick High School.

Net proceeds benefit the West Suburban Special Recreation Association, which provides recreation services for adults and children with physical impairments, developmental delays, mental disabilities or other disabilities.

The walk/run will begin 8 a.m., on Monroe Street, a half-block south of Division Street. The race route will take runners and walkers on a 3.1-mile course through River Forest’s flat, tree-lined streets before ending on Concordia University Chicago’s Cougar Stadium track.
